  • Patent number: 9304471
    Abstract: An image forming apparatus includes a discharge tray, a plurality of ribs, a ventilation duct, a ventilation hole, and an air flow generating portion. On the discharge tray, a sheet having been subjected to a fixing process for thermally fixing a toner image on the sheet is discharged. The plurality of ribs are formed on the discharge tray. The ventilation duct is formed on a side of an end among opposite ends of each of the plurality of ribs. The ventilation hole is formed in a partition wall separating the ventilation duct from a sheet mounting area of the discharge tray, and formed in a vicinity of the end of each of the plurality of ribs on the partition wall side. The air flow generating portion is configured to generate, via the ventilation duct, air flow between outside of an apparatus main body and spaces between the ribs.

  • Patent number: 9036226
    Abstract: A reading device includes an original glass plate, a scanner, a support portion, a towing portion, a guide portion, and an engagement portion. The towing portion is configured to tow and move the support portion in a predetermined direction. The guide portion is configured to guide a direction of movement of the support portion and the scanner caused by the towing of the towing portion. A center of mass of the scanner and the support portion is positioned at a midpoint between contact portions provided at both ends of the scanner and coming into contact with the original glass plate. The guide portion is disposed under the center of mass of the scanner and support portion. The towing portion is secured to the support portion or the engagement portion at a point on a vertical line passing through the center of mass of the scanner and support portion.
